A wealthy coal merchant built a house here in 1915 and this is now a youth hostel which is open all year round. Finnhamn was bought by Stockholm City in 1943.

, have scheduled ferry services to the islands. The journey takes around two and a half hours from the centre of Stockholm.

Other facilities on Finnhamn are holiday cabins, and a seasonally open restaurant and shop.
